Journalism Revolutionized: How Technology is Shaping the Future of Reporting
The landscape of journalism is evolving at an unprecedented pace thanks to advancements in technology. Automation tools are streamlining routine tasks, freeing up journalists to focus on more in-depth reporting. Artificial intelligence (AI) is also making its mark, fueling everything from news gathering to the generation of basic content. This influx of technology presents both possibilities and questions for the future of journalism.

The future of reporting will likely involve a hybrid approach, with journalists collaborating with technology to produce more informative, engaging, and relevant content.
How Social Media Shapes Political Dialogue: A Blessing and a Curse
Social media networks have altered the landscape of political discourse, presenting both unprecedented opportunities and significant challenges. On one hand, social media enables individuals to contribute in political debates like never before, sharing information and viewpoints quickly. However, the same attributes that enable this interaction can also contribute the spread of disinformation and division, undermining the basis of civil discourse.
- Additionally, the algorithms used by social media companies often create echo chambers, amplifying pre-existing opinions and reducing exposure to diverse ideas.
- Consequently, it is essential for individuals to interact with social media thoughtfully, assessing the content they access and pursuing out multiple perspectives.
Tech's Impact Beyond the Screen: The Effect of Tech on Human Connection and Society
As our relationship on technology deepens, it's imperative to scrutinize its impact on human relationships and society as a whole. While tech has undeniably streamlined communication and reach to information, it has also raised worries about its potential to diminish genuine human interaction.
There's a growing recognition that excessive screen time can lead disconnection, particularly among younger populations. The filtered nature of online interactions can create a sense of inauthenticity that adversely impacts our ability to cultivate meaningful relationships.
It's crucial to find a equilibrium between the opportunities offered by technology and the importance of real-world human engagement. This requires conscious effort to emphasize face-to-face interactions, engage in meaningful activities, and cultivate a sense of community beyond the digital realm.
